`
wangzi6hao
  • 浏览: 212554 次
  • 性别: Icon_minigender_1
  • 来自: sdf
社区版块
存档分类
最新评论

tomcat6两次加载配置文件 proxool连接池多次加载 proxool启动双倍连接数量

阅读更多

server.xml配置是这样的。每次启动的时候,都会两次加载proxool.本来设置的打开100个连接,这一下每次就会打开200个连接了。很郁闷。最后发现问题的所在。所以改成下面红色的配置就好了。

<Host name="webGame" appBase="E:\workspace0\webGame"
unpackWARs="true" autoDeploy="true"
xmlValidation="false" xmlNamespaceAware="false">

<Alias>127.0.0.1</Alias>
<Context path="/" docBase="WebRoot" reloadable="true"
caseSensitive="false" debug="0"></Context>
</Host> 

 改成:

<Host name="webGame" appBase=""
unpackWARs="true" autoDeploy="true"
xmlValidation="false" xmlNamespaceAware="false">

<Alias>127.0.0.1</Alias>
<Context path="/" docBase="E:\workspace0\webGame\WebRoot" reloadable="true"
caseSensitive="false" debug="0"></Context>
</Host>

 主要问题是下面的配置文件没有有绝对路径的问题。

最后还要告诉大家的是,有时候tomcat6会把项目复制到webapps下,这样也会出错多次加载web.xml.我当时就出错了proxool文件被加载了3次的情况.那个泪奔啊.............

分享到:
评论

相关推荐

    proxool连接池配置文件

    项目实用的proxool连接池配置文件,每个标签都有注释,可以直接拿来使用

    在Hibernate中配置Proxool连接池

    在上述配置中,我们通过`hibernate.proxool.properties`指定了Proxool的配置文件路径,`hibernate.proxool.pool_alias`设置了连接池的别名,这个别名需要与Proxool配置文件中的alias一致。 接下来,我们需要创建...

    proxool连接池用户名密码加密

    使用Proxool的加密功能,开发者需要在程序启动时加载加密库,并且确保在应用程序的整个生命周期内,只有拥有正确密钥的组件才能解密这些数据。这需要谨慎处理密钥的存储和分发,以防止密钥泄露。 在实际应用中,...

    proxool连接池配置详解

    ### Proxool连接池配置详解 #### 一、概述 Proxool是一个开源的轻量级Java数据库连接池实现,其主要目标是替代常见的数据库连接池解决方案,如C3P0或DBCP,并且提供了更加灵活和易于配置的特性。在实际应用中,...

    proxool连接池使用详细说明

    Proxool连接池是数据库连接管理的一种解决方案,它允许应用程序高效地管理和复用数据库连接,以提高系统的性能和响应速度。下面将详细讲解Proxool连接池的使用方法及其核心概念。 1. **Proxool简介** Proxool是...

    proxool连接池配置

    -- 连接池的别名 --&gt; &lt;alias&gt;DBPool&lt;/alias&gt; - &lt;!-- proxool只能管理由自己产生的连接 --&gt; &lt;driver-url&gt;jdbc:sqlserver://localhost:1433;dataBaseName=books&lt;/driver-url&gt; - &lt;!-- JDBC驱动程序 --&gt; ...

    proxool连接池jar包

    3. 初始化连接池:在应用启动时加载配置,并初始化Proxool连接池。 4. 获取和释放连接:在需要访问数据库时,从连接池中获取连接;完成操作后,记得释放回连接池,而不是直接关闭。 5. 监控和诊断:定期检查Proxool...

    Hibernate Proxool连接池配置总结及常遇问题

    如果Proxool配置文件未正确加载,可能会导致连接池无法初始化。检查`hibernate.proxool.xml`的路径是否正确,确保配置文件存在于指定位置。 **(2)连接超时** 当连接池中的连接被长时间占用不释放,可能导致连接...

    proxool连接池

    2. 配置Proxool的XML文件,定义连接池的参数,如最大连接数、最小连接数、超时时间等。例如: ```xml &lt;proxool.pool&gt; &lt;driver-url&gt;jdbc:mysql://localhost:3306/test &lt;driver-class&gt;...

    proxool连接池所涉及的jar包文件

    这两个jar包的协同工作使得Java应用程序可以通过Proxool连接池管理和控制到MySQL数据库的连接。 配置Proxool时,你需要在应用的配置文件(如:`proxool.properties`)中设置一系列属性,例如: 1. `proxool.mysql....

    基于ssh的proxool连接池配置

    3. `url`属性的值`proxool.DbPool`是数据库连接池的别名,这个别名必须与`proxool.xml`配置文件中的`Alias`一致,以便Proxool知道如何创建和管理连接。 4. `LocalSessionFactoryBean`是Hibernate的配置,用于创建...

    Proxool连接池使用方法

    Proxool连接池使用方法 首先, 你要把下载 proxool 的 lib 下面所有的 jar 文件, 放到 WEB-INF/lib 下面, 另外, 把你的 jdbc driver 也放到相同的 lib,

    Spring+Hibernate+Proxool连接池

    在描述中提到的“连接池配置文件”,通常是指像`proxoolconf.xml`这样的文件,其中包含了Proxool连接池的配置参数。这些参数包括但不限于: 1. **poolName**:唯一标识连接池的名称,方便管理和调试。 2. **...

    Proxool连接池jar包

    2. 在Java代码中加载配置,初始化Proxool连接池。 3. 通过JDBC的DataSource接口获取数据库连接,这些连接实际上是Proxool代理的连接。 4. 使用获取的连接进行数据库操作,完成后释放连接,实际上返回给连接池,供...

    Spring2.5配置proxool连接池

    Spring2.5配置proxool连接池

    ssh2简单案例,注解+proxool连接池+sf4j记录日志

    在Java应用程序中,开发者可以通过配置文件设定连接池的参数,如最大连接数、超时时间等,并在需要时从连接池中获取连接。 SF4J(Simple Logging Facade for Java)是一个轻量级的日志框架,为其他日志API提供了一...

    配置Hibernate使用Proxool连接池

    3. Proxool配置:除了在Hibernate配置文件中设置基本的数据库连接信息,我们还可以在Proxool的配置文件(如proxool.xml)中设置更详细的连接池参数,比如最大连接数、最小空闲连接数、超时时间等,以优化连接池性能...

    Proxool连接池配置

    综上所述,Proxool连接池配置涉及多个步骤,包括环境准备、配置文件编写、连接获取、状态监控以及参数化配置。这些步骤共同构成了高效数据库连接管理的基础,有助于提升Java应用的性能和可维护性。

Global site tag (gtag.js) - Google Analytics